Meaning & origin

Vanisha is an extremely rare American name, first recorded in 1972 and peaking in 1994. It has never ranked in the top 1000, with an estimated one in several million girls receiving the name. Its trajectory is stable at very low usage. The name likely emerged as a modern variant of Vanessa, following the trend of 'isha' endings popular in the late 20th century. No top states are associated with Vanisha, underscoring its scarcity. While possibly influenced by Indian naming traditions, its exact origin remains unclear. Parents choosing Vanisha are selecting a distinctive, rarely heard name.

Vanisha first appeared in the United States in the 1970s, likely a creative respelling or elaboration of the name Vanessa, which itself was invented by Jonathan Swift. In Indian contexts, Vanisha may be a feminine form of Vanish, a name of uncertain origin though sometimes associated with the Sanskrit word for 'forest' or 'fire'. The name remains uncommon.
